Way 4: Via Local Group Policy
1.
Press theWindows + Rto initiate the Run dialog box.
Go to the following path:
Computer Configuration\Administrative Templates\System\Power Management\Sleep options
3.
Double-clickRequire a password when a computer wakes (plugged in)to selectDisabledand clickApply>OK.
Go back toSleep Settingsagain and findRequire a password when a computer wakes (On battery).
ChooseDisableand clickApply>OK.
